    Props to "Monte"

    Just thought this would be a fitting offering for my 5242nd post…

    Back in the days before I joined this BT community, I lurked here as a guest for quite some time. There was a guy here who most of you old-timers will remember. His handle was “Monte”. He was a prolific poster, but without all the wisecracks and stuff that I, for instance, am known for. His posts were informative, upbeat and supportive, with good info for those that wanted it, and often just a “well done” for those that needed it. He was always ready with a compliment.

    I remember feeling sad when news was posted that he had died in his beloved shop one day. But I also remember an embarrassing feeling of envy that he had gone out in so perfect a way. It’s probably the way I would want for myself (but not yet… ). When my grandkids are of that age (and it’s not long before they will be), I hope I can be like him, and take them into my shop to stimulate their interest, teach them what I know, and spend quality time.

    So, as I tread across hallowed ground, I raise my glass out of respect for a man I never met, but many of us will remember, and felt we knew. This one’s for you, Monte…

              Monte and I split a big order of K-Body clamps when Bessey was having their 25th anniversary (or whatever it was) sale, in late 2005. The clamps were being sold in lots of four that included two 12" and two 24". He needed one size, I needed the other, so we made the necessary arrangements and did the deal. A scant four months later I logged on here one day and learned that he had passed. I was stunned. It seemed impossible then, and still does today.

              On the first two anniversaries of his death, I started a thread to mark the occasion. Sometime around mid-May of this year I realized I'd not done that in 2009. I am always reluctant to blame technology for my own failings, but upon investigating the matter I determined that changing from one smartphone to another had apparently hosed the pop-up reminder I had in place. I'll make sure that won't ever happen again.

              I once asked Monte how he got his "Forum Windbag" handle. He said it just popped up automatically one day, after his 5000th post, more than anyone else then had. He thought it was funny. IINM Sam fixed the forum software following Monte's death so that no one else would ever "earn" that title.

              He was a great guy. I still miss him.
